Responsibilities

  • Conduct thorough patient screenings, including a review of oral health history, medical history, and vital signs.
  • Perform comprehensive periodontal assessments, including charting, probing depths, and evaluating recession.
  • Identify patient risk factors and develop individualized treatment plans.
  • Perform dental prophylaxis, scaling, and root planing procedures to remove plaque, calculus (tartar), and stains.
  • Administer local anesthesia as certified and in accordance with New Jersey state regulations and practice protocol.
  • Apply fluoride treatments, sealants, and other preventive agents.
  • Perform non-surgical periodontal maintenance procedures.
  • Expose, process, and interpret dental radiographs (X-rays) using digital radiography systems for diagnostic purposes.
  • Educate patients on proper oral hygiene techniques, including effective brushing, flossing, and interdental cleaning methods.
  • Provide tailored instruction on the relationship between oral health and systemic health.
  • Counsel patients on the impact of diet, nutrition, and lifestyle choices on oral health.
  • Discuss smoking cessation and other relevant preventive measures.
  • Maintain a clean, safe, and sterile environment in compliance with OSHA standards, CDC guidelines, and infection control protocols.
  • Ensure proper sterilization and disinfection of instruments and equipment.
  • Collaborate effectively with dentists, specialists, and other members of the dental team to coordinate and deliver comprehensive patient care.
  • Communicate clearly and professionally with patients, addressing their concerns and answering their questions.
  • Document patient care, treatment plans, and recommendations accurately and comprehensively in electronic health records (EHR).
  • Participate in continuing education courses and professional development activities to maintain licensure and stay abreast of the latest advancements in dental hygiene.
